Modular Cables

1. Overview

Modular cables are standardized, customizable cable assemblies designed for flexible connectivity in electronic systems. Their plug-and-play architecture enables rapid deployment, scalability, and maintenance efficiency. These cables serve as critical infrastructure in data centers, industrial automation, and telecommunications, supporting seamless integration of hardware components while maintaining signal integrity and power delivery.

3. Structural Composition

Typical modular cables feature:

  • Conductive Core: Annealed copper (20-24 AWG) with oxygen-free purity ( 99.95%)
  • Insulation: Cross-linked polyethylene (XLPE) or fluorinated ethylene propylene (FEP)
  • Shielding: Braided aluminum/mylar layers with 95%+ coverage
  • Connectors: Hot-swappable RJ45/USB-C/M12 interfaces with 500+ mating cycles
  • Strain Relief: Thermoplastic elastomer (TPE) boots for 20N+ tensile strength

7. Selection Guidelines

Key considerations:

  • Signal Integrity: Match impedance (100 15%) for high-speed applications
  • Environmental Factors: Select UV-resistant jacketing for outdoor deployment
  • Standards Compliance: Verify UL/CSA/IEC certification
  • Cost Optimization: Balance conductor material quality vs budget constraints
